Zantech is looking for a talented Cybersecurity Certification and Accreditation Analyst to support our Federal Client during a cutting-edge enterprise information technology implementation.

This upcoming project offers cloud infrastructure specialists an opportunity to manage and secure federal hosting environments requiring high-level security compliance. This project provides capacity planning, disaster recovery implementation, and providing 24/7 technical support for mission-critical applications in AWS GovCloud environments. Ideal candidates will have experience with infrastructure as a service (IaaS), security compliance frameworks like NIST and RMF, and technical skills in areas such as virtualization, monitoring, and network security.

Responsibilities include, but not limited to:
  • Serves as a cybersecurity Subject Matter Expert for Authorization of information systems
  • Fully versed in DoD implementation of authorization process and supporting policies/procedures
  • Performs DoD cybersecurity process for authorizing information systems
  • Understands how NIST 800-53 security controls apply to assessing and authorizing large IT infrastructures
  • Determines severity of identified vulnerabilities and ramifications on system authorization
  • Briefs senior management on progress/results of systems undergoing authorization

Required Qualifications:
  • Five years of relevant C&A experience, Risk Management Framework (RMF) and NIST C&A experience, DOD cybersecurity experience
  • DOD Secret Clearance (TOP SECRET for DLA CERT duty)
  • Must be eligible for IT II
  • Relevant certification meeting DOD 8570.01 IAM level III (or IAT level II for CERT personnel)
  • Experience assessing security controls and conducting authorization reviews for large, complex organizations
  • Computing Environment certifications as specified
